Heim > Web-Frontend > js-Tutorial > Hauptteil

So verwenden Sie die POST-Anfragemethode in jQuery

PHPz
Freigeben: 2024-02-28 21:03:03
Original
827 Leute haben es durchsucht

So verwenden Sie die POST-Anfragemethode in jQuery

So verwenden Sie die POST-Anforderungsmethode in jQuery

Bei der Webentwicklung ist häufig die Dateninteraktion zwischen der Front-End-Seite und dem Back-End-Server beteiligt. Unter diesen ist die POST-Anfrage eine häufig verwendete Methode. Über die POST-Anfrage können Sie Daten an den Backend-Server senden und das entsprechende Rückgabeergebnis erhalten. jQuery ist eine beliebte JavaScript-Bibliothek, die eine bequeme Möglichkeit bietet, AJAX-Anfragen zu stellen. In diesem Artikel wird die Verwendung der POST-Methode in jQuery für die Datenübertragung vorgestellt und spezifische Codebeispiele bereitgestellt.

1. Einführung der jQuery-Bibliothek

Zuerst müssen Sie die jQuery-Bibliothek in die HTML-Seite einführen. Sie können die neueste Version von jQuery über einen CDN-Link einführen oder sie lokal herunterladen, wie unten gezeigt:

<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
Nach dem Login kopieren

2. Initiieren Sie eine POST-Anfrage

Verwenden Sie die $.post()-Methode von jQuery, um eine POST-Anfrage zu senden. Diese Methode akzeptiert drei Parameter: die angeforderte URL, die gesendeten Daten und eine Rückruffunktion zur Verarbeitung der Antwort nach erfolgreicher Anfrage.

$.post("http://example.com/api/data", {key1: value1, key2: value2}, function(data, status){
    // 处理响应数据
    console.log("Data: " + data);
    console.log("Status: " + status);
});
Nach dem Login kopieren

Im obigen Codebeispiel haben wir eine POST-Anfrage an „http://example.com/api/data“ gesendet und ein Datenobjekt mit zwei Schlüssel-Wert-Paaren, Schlüssel1 und Schlüssel2, gesendet. Nachdem die Anfrage erfolgreich war, wird die Rückruffunktion aufgerufen und die Serverantwortdaten und der Status der Anfrage werden zur Verarbeitung an die Rückruffunktion übergeben.

3. Antwortdaten verarbeiten

In der Rückruffunktion können nach erfolgreicher POST-Anfrage die vom Server zurückgegebenen Daten verarbeitet werden. Normalerweise gibt der Server Daten im JSON-Format zurück, die für den Betrieb über die Methode JSON.parse() in ein JavaScript-Objekt konvertiert werden können.

$.post("http://example.com/api/data", {key1: value1, key2: value2}, function(data, status){
    // 处理响应数据
    var responseData = JSON.parse(data);
    console.log("Response Data: ", responseData);
    console.log("Status: " + status);
});
Nach dem Login kopieren

4. Fehlerbehandlung

Beim Senden einer POST-Anfrage können Netzwerkfehler, serverseitige Fehler usw. auftreten, daher müssen Fehler behandelt werden. Die Rückruffunktion zur Fehlerbehandlung kann im vierten Parameter der Methode $.post() angegeben werden.

$.post("http://example.com/api/data", {key1: value1, key2: value2}, function(data, status){
    // 处理响应数据
    var responseData = JSON.parse(data);
    console.log("Response Data: ", responseData);
    console.log("Status: " + status);
}).fail(function(jqXHR, textStatus, errorThrown){
    console.log("Error occurred: " + errorThrown);
});
Nach dem Login kopieren

Zusammenfassung

Dieser Artikel stellt die Methode der Datenübertragung mithilfe der POST-Methode in jQuery vor und enthält spezifische Codebeispiele. Durch POST-Anfragen kann die Front-End-Seite Daten an den Back-End-Server senden und die Antwortergebnisse erhalten, wodurch die Dateninteraktion zwischen der Seite und dem Server realisiert wird. POST-Anfragen werden in der Webentwicklung häufig verwendet, und es ist für Front-End-Entwickler sehr wichtig, die Verwendung von POST-Anfragen zu beherrschen.

Das obige ist der detaillierte Inhalt vonSo verwenden Sie die POST-Anfragemethode in jQuery.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age